Authenticating such a pair would require meticulous examination. Features to look for include:
* The Prada logo: The authenticity of any Prada item hinges on the quality and placement of the Prada logo. Counterfeit Prada shoes often exhibit inconsistencies in logo design, font, and placement. The logo should be flawlessly executed, with consistent stitching and clear lettering.
* Materials: Genuine Prada shoes use high-quality materials. The leather should be supple yet firm, the stitching should be precise and even, and the overall construction should feel solid and well-made. The glossy finish itself should be even and consistent, without any imperfections or unevenness.
* Hardware: The buckles, eyelets, and other metal components should be of high quality, exhibiting a consistent finish and free from tarnish or damage.
* Internal markings: Authentic Prada shoes often have internal markings, such as size codes and manufacturing information, which can be used to verify authenticity. These markings should be discreet yet clearly visible.
* Box and accessories: While not always essential for authentication, the presence of the original Prada box, dust bag, and any accompanying documentation significantly increases the likelihood of authenticity.
